Description
Imagine being a military commander in ancient times, tasked with either defending or breaching the walls of Jerusalem, a city torn apart by internal conflict and rebellion. Storm Over Jerusalem: The Roman Siege drops you into the midst of this brutal siege, which lasted nearly five months in 70 AD. As one of two players, you'll take on the role of either the Roman forces, led by Titus, or the Judean forces, comprised of various factions vying for control. The game masterfully recreates the tension and uncertainty of this pivotal moment in history, with each side facing unique challenges and opportunities. The game features an engaging area-impulse system, allowing players to make tactical decisions about when and where to act. This is augmented by a deck of tactical cards, which can represent everything from battering rams and siege towers to famine and sabotage. These cards add a layer of unpredictability to the game, making each playthrough feel fresh and dynamic.
